November

by Leonard M Hawkes

Autumn's Gold is ocher now, or less;
The summer's charge for Green now laid to rest,
And Cold, a staunch companion every Night,
And Warmth, the hope of Day, a gift of Light.

Settling-in I wait now for the Snow,
Short icy days--and Christmas' Glow.
